加密货币交易机器人:工作原理与构建方法
加密货币 24/7 不停交易。你的注意力却做不到。机器人解决了这种不对称——但前提是它的构建以执行纪律为本,而不仅仅是一个聪明的信号。本指南拆解加密货币交易机器人内部到底在做什么,哪些策略系列能跨周期存活,以及如何在一个下午内不写代码地上线。

加密货币 24/7 不停交易。你的注意力却做不到。机器人解决了这种不对称——但前提是它的构建以执行纪律为本,而不仅仅是一个聪明的信号。本指南拆解加密货币交易机器人内部到底在做什么,哪些策略系列能跨周期存活,以及如何在一个下午内不写代码地上线。
读完之后,你将拥有一份可用的蓝图、对机器人能做与不能做的现实认知,以及一份将业余项目与生产系统区分开来的风险控制清单。
加密货币交易机器人到底是什么
加密货币交易机器人是一种软件,通过 API 连接你的交易所,并根据你定义的规则执行交易。你不再盯K线,而是指定入场条件、出场条件和风险参数——让机器完成其余工作。
在底层,每个机器人都跑同一套循环:
- 摄取数据(价格、成交量、指标,有时还包括新闻或链上指标)
- 根据你的规则集评估条件
- 通过交易所 API 下单、修改或撤单
- 更新内部状态(持仓、风险上限、敞口)
- 记录所有内容以便复盘
简单的机器人运行基于规则的逻辑——若 RSI > 50 且趋势向上则买入。 更复杂的系统结合多个时间周期、波动率过滤、市场状态检测和新闻触发。两者都叫"机器人"。只有一种能挺过真正的熊市。
决定机器人是否能用的五个组件
机器人在可预测的地方失败。就是这五个地方。
1. 数据摄取
机器人依赖价格、成交量、订单簿深度,有时是资金费率或链上数据,以及越来越多的新闻流。垃圾进,垃圾出。数据延迟 4 秒的机器人,会在已经不存在的价格上交易。
2. 信号生成
逻辑栖身之处。确定性规则(若价格 < 50 EMA 则平多)、统计模型(均值回归 z 分数)或组合条件(只有高时间周期一致且波动率低于阈值时才进入动量交易)。单指标机器人是交易界的快餐——容易做,容易后悔。
3. 执行
将一份漂亮的回测与一份亏损的实盘记录分开的东西。好的机器人处理订单类型(限价、市价、post-only、IOC),原子化地放置止损和止盈,并考虑滑点。在薄的山寨币订单簿上,你的"1.00 美元买入"可能在 1.04 美元成交。把这个乘以每月 200 笔交易。
4. 风险管理
仓位规模与波动率挂钩(例如 1/ATR)。交易所端的硬止损。每日亏损上限。最大同时持仓数。全局熔断。这些不是可选项。它们是糟糕的一周与账户清零之间的分水岭。
5. 监控
每个决策的日志、行为偏离预期时的报警、实盘盈亏看板,以及无需平仓即可暂停的方式。无人监管运行的机器人最终会做出愚蠢的事。
优秀的自动化将清晰规则、快速执行与严格风险限制结合起来。三者占其二是不够的。
在加密市场可用的策略家族
不存在通用的最佳策略。每个家族适合某种市场状态;操作员的工作就是把策略与市场对上。
趋势跟随
当中期均线向上拐头、价格突破近期高点且动量确认时买入。加入更高时间周期过滤以减少假突破,并使用基于 ATR 的移动止损。在方向性行情中有效;在震荡中流血。
均值回归
在区间中对布林带触碰做反向交易。RSI 超买卖出,超卖买入。配合区间状态检测器——ADX 上穿 25 时关闭。在突破中做均值回归,正是新手的死法。
突破与回踩
等待压缩(N 根 K 线的低 ATR),在突破时入场,止损置于结构之外。如果行情延续,谨慎金字塔加仓。突破失败时立即出场——或在状态过滤器仍一致的情况下反手。
事件驱动
ETF 批准、代币解锁、交易所宕机、宏观数据。加密对这些反应快速且不对称。事件驱动机器人需要干净的数据源和紧凑的风险包装,但能捕捉到纯价格系统完全错过的优势。
做市与套利
首个机器人请跳过。两者都需要费率档位优化、库存对冲以及大多数零售操作者不具备的基础设施。先在六个月里干净地跑通一个方向性系统,再回来做这些。
如何不自欺地进行回测
回测是机器人悄然死亡的地方。五条不可妥协的实践:
| 实践 | 为什么重要 |
|---|---|
| 纳入手续费与滑点 | 5 个基点的优势在 4 个基点的成本下会死;两者都要真实建模 |
| 使用 K 线收盘逻辑 | 若你的规则在收盘触发,回测也必须如此——禁止盘中偷看 |
| 样本外测试 | 留下开发期间模型从未见过的数据 |
| 滚动前向验证 | 用第 1–12 周训练、第 13 周测试,向前滑动——重复 |
| 多个市场状态 | 在牛市(2020)、熊市(2022)、震荡(2023)、复苏(2024)中验证 |
不要只看头条收益。回撤深度、回撤持续时间、盈利因子和参数敏感度比年化收益告诉你更多。如果小幅参数变化就摧毁结果,优势是脆弱的——不要交易它。
存活下来的机器人,不是那些回测最漂亮的,而是那些回测在样本外和跨市场状态中仍能站住脚的。
使用 Obside 在几分钟内构建加密交易机器人
大多数交易者从未自动化,因为他们以为需要写代码。其实不需要。Obside 接受自然英语,将其编译成可执行策略,运行超快速回测,并通过你连接的交易所路由订单。它在 2024 巴黎交易博览会上获得创新奖,并得到 Microsoft for Startups 的支持。
第 1 步:描述规则
在 Obside Copilot 中写:
当 BTC 在 2 小时图上收于 100 EMA 之上,且 RSI 低于 70 时,开多。止损 2 ATR,止盈 3 ATR。若 2 小时 Supertrend 转空则平仓。
Copilot 会将这句话转化为可执行策略。
第 2 步:加入过滤器
仅在 8 小时趋势向上或日成交量高于 20 日均量时允许入场。 在重大经济数据公布前后暂停交易。
过滤器把业余者与操作员分开。它们在回测中不花成本,通常给夏普率增加 0.2–0.5。
第 3 步:即刻回测
在 BTC、ETH 以及一小撮流动山寨币上跑。审视权益曲线、回撤以及结果分布。如果大多数亏损集中在某一种市场状态,加一个过滤器或拆成两个机器人。
第 4 步:模拟交易
确认实盘行为与回测一致。这里你会发现延迟、部分成交和拒单。最少两周。
第 5 步:带约束上线
每笔风险 0.5–1%。每日亏损上限 3%。最多两个同时持仓。仅交易权限的 API 密钥。无提现权限。从可以无所谓地亏掉的规模开始。
第 6 步:监控与迭代
为超过阈值的滑点或超出预期的连败设置报警。慢慢调整——一次只调一个参数,这样才能归因。
三个今天就能搭建的具体例子:
BTC 动量摆动。 当 2h Supertrend 转多、RSI 在 40–65 之间且 8h 确认时入场。止损 5 ATR(2h),价格朝你方向走 2 ATR 后改为 3 ATR 移动止损。Supertrend 反转时出场。
流动山寨币区间回归。 扫描 20 日 ATR 低于阈值的币种。当 30m RSI 低于 35 且 4h 趋势平坦时,在布林带下轨做多。在中轨或 RSI 50 出场。
事件驱动的逢低买入。 若价格在 10 分钟内伴随高成交量下跌 3%+,且检测到正面新闻标题,小量买入 BTC。紧凑的风险,快速的出场。
好处——以及无人提及的代价
机器人执行毫不犹豫、不会疲劳、没有恐惧。它们同时监控数十个交易对。它们以毫秒级反应。它们让纪律变得便宜。
但自动化只去除情绪,不去除责任:
- 过拟合是沉默的杀手。 干净的逻辑、样本外验证、最小化优化。
- 手续费和滑点吃掉薄优势。 始终纳入;偏爱流动性强的交易对。
- 基础设施会坏。 交易所宕机、API 限频、网络抖动。构建重试与幂等。
- 市场状态切换会发生。 趋势策略在震荡中可能流血数月。加入显式的状态过滤。
- 杠杆要命。 在首个机器人上避免使用。大多数爆仓来自杠杆,不是信号质量。
选择加密交易机器人平台
如果你打算选平台而非从零搭建,按生产中真正重要的标准评判:
| 检查什么 | 为什么 |
|---|---|
| 回测真实性 | 手续费、滑点、部分成交、滚动前向——否则就是在撒谎 |
| 交易所连接性 | 与你交易场所的原生 API 集成 |
| 风险控制 | 单笔止损、日上限、熔断开关、敞口限制 |
| 信号灵活性 | 多时间周期、多资产、新闻/事件触发 |
| 迭代速度 | 从想法到运行策略所需时间——分钟级,而非周级 |
| 透明度 | 每个决策有日志,每个成交可审计 |
Obside 围绕这些要求设计。你用自然英语对话,回测以秒计完成,订单经由你连接的交易所路由,市场让你能在其他交易者已实盘压力测试过的策略上做调整。
下一步该做什么
挑一个币、一个时间周期、一组能用一句话描述的规则。用真实手续费和滑点回测。模拟交易两周。用小仓位上线。一次只加一个改进。
如果想跳过工程,免费创建一个 Obside 账户,向 Copilot 描述一个策略,看着回测跑起来。你在喝完咖啡之前就会拥有一个能用的机器人。等到数字和你的神经都同意时,再连接你的交易所。
仅作教育内容。这不是投资建议。交易涉及风险,包括可能的本金损失。
常见问题
加密交易机器人在实际中能赚多少?
完全取决于策略质量、执行和市场环境。在纪律化的风险管理下追逐清晰优势的机器人能产生有吸引力的风险调整收益。在低流动性交易对上过拟合的机器人表现不佳。请通过有意义样本上的回撤、夏普率和盈利因子来判断——而不是一段六周运行的头条收益。
运行加密交易机器人需要编程吗?
不需要。Obside 等平台接受自然英语的策略描述,并将其编译为可执行规则。如果你想要专有数据源或不寻常的逻辑,编程会有帮助;但无代码现在已覆盖多时间周期、新闻触发和组合层面的策略。
加密交易机器人安全吗?
机器人的安全程度取决于它运行的规则和监控它的操作员。把 API 密钥限制为仅交易权限,绝不开启提现。使用止损、每日亏损上限和全局熔断。从模拟交易开始,然后小规模实盘,只有当实盘结果与回测吻合时再扩大规模。
哪些指标最适合加密机器人?
没有通用答案。RSI、移动平均线、MACD、ATR 和 Supertrend 是常用构件。重要的是你如何把它们与过滤器结合——高时间周期确认、波动率状态、成交量阈值。诚实地测试,把逻辑保持得足够简单,能用一句话解释。
起步需要多少资金?
你可以在支持小额订单的交易所用几百美元开始。在这个规模上,手续费和滑点占主导,所以用它来验证实盘成交是否与回测假设一致。大多数零售策略在 2,000–10,000 美元之间才开始有意义。
加密机器人能对新闻和宏观事件作出反应吗?
可以,前提是平台将事件触发作为一等条件。Obside 允许你写诸如 若宣布新关税则卖出我的持仓 或 每周一上午 10:00 买入 50 美元 BTC 这样的规则。事件驱动逻辑正是大多数零售机器人最薄弱之处——也是当前大部分优势所在。